cherbear4000 Posted February 5, 2012 #1 Share Posted February 5, 2012 We use the Discover Card cash back bonuses toward our cruises. There is a specific travel agency that you must use to be able to get the discount. The employees at the travel agency are not the brightest and we are unhappy with them. We are trying to book 6 cabins relatively near one another. Some balcony, some inside, some with 3 to a room. The travel agency was unable to find cabins near each other for the sailing we want. We called Carnival directly to check on cabin availability, and the employee at Carnival was able to find the cabins and give us the cabin numbers to give to the TA. The person at Carnival was so helpful, we feel like he should get credit for the booking, but by booking with the TA we will save around $1000 because of the Discover cash back bonus. Can we book with Carnival and then transfer the bookings? Would the employee at Carnival would still get the credit if we transfer?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
firefly333 Posted February 5, 2012 #2 Share Posted February 5, 2012 If you have to use the TA to book, I dont see how you could book with Carnival and then transfer and use the bonuses? If it is a regular TA, then you have 60 days I believe to transfer the booking from carnival to a TA. (RCL only allows 30, so thats why I sometimes forget, but Im pretty sure Carnival is 60 days).
